What keeps burning gases from leaking out between the sides of the piston and the cylinder wall and also aids in good compression?

The piston skirt is the correct choice because it plays a crucial role in the function of the piston within the engine cylinder. The skirt of the piston is the part that extends downward from the piston head and helps maintain the alignment of the piston as it moves up and down within the cylinder. Its design is essential for minimizing the clearance between the piston and the cylinder wall.

The tight fit of the piston skirt against the cylinder wall prevents burning gases from leaking out during the combustion process, which is vital for maintaining high compression in internal combustion engines. This effective seal ensures that the combustion pressure is contained, allowing the engine to operate efficiently and produce the desired power output.

In contrast, while the other options relate to functions within an engine, they do not address the specific role of preventing gas leaks and aiding compression as directly as the piston skirt does. The cylinder head is primarily responsible for sealing the combustion chamber at the top of the cylinder, valve seals focus on preventing oil leaks around the valves, and gaskets provide seals between various engine components but do not have the primary role of managing gas leakage at the piston-cylinder interface.
